Names and origin
| Protein names | Recommended name: Alcohol dehydrogenase [acceptor] EC=1.1.99.- | ||||
| Gene names |
| ||||
| Encoded on | Plasmid OCT | ||||
| Organism | Pseudomonas oleovorans | ||||
| Taxonomic identifier | 301 [NCBI] | ||||
| Taxonomic lineage | Bacteria › Proteobacteria › Gammaproteobacteria › Pseudomonadales › Pseudomonadaceae › Pseudomonas |
Protein attributes
| Sequence length | 558 AA. |
| Sequence status | Complete. |
| Sequence processing | The displayed sequence is not processed. |
| Protein existence | Evidence at protein level. |
General annotation (Comments)
| Function | Converts aliphatic medium-chain-length alcohols into aldehydes. May be linked to the electron transfer chain. |
| Catalytic activity | Alcohol + acceptor = aldehyde + reduced acceptor. |
| Cofactor | FAD By similarity. |
| Subcellular location | |
| Sequence similarities | Belongs to the GMC oxidoreductase family. |
